Output 42388fc565e69b03ee2af78278b20e3278f0b23e1c09fe0d36b203af0870615e:0

value
1561694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ec03d2fd3294cc010e1bb497148436a3b6e1ce OP_EQUAL
address
39ABPgphaoHYQzDSTb8E3dcvMFSCxzkgLm
transaction
42388fc565e69b03ee2af78278b20e3278f0b23e1c09fe0d36b203af0870615e
confirmations
182141
spent
true